Conservation Professional (45%): Professionals in this role focus on conserving, maintaining, and preserving historical stone structures. They often work in collaboration with other experts to ensure cultural and historical significance is maintained. 2. Stone Mason (30%): Stone masons work with various types of stone to build, repair, and restore different structures. They use traditional techniques and modern tools to achieve accurate and durable results. 3. Architectural Stone Carver (15%): Architectural stone carvers create decorative and structural elements for buildings using a variety of stones. Their skills include drawing, designing, and executing intricate carvings in line with architectural specifications. 4. Stone Sculptor (10%): Stone sculptors specialize in crafting artistic sculptures from various types of stone. They rely on creativity, technical skills, and patience to bring their visions to life.
